summ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Changgyu Choi <changyu.choi@samsung.com>2020-11-03 11:21:57 +0900
committerChanggyu Choi <changyu.choi@samsung.com>2020-11-03 11:22:02 +0900
commit15790afec1c924540e7c3ec613c5b3d2adcbed46 (patch)
tree3c79138996c7010a29411944eb7dece54d626ab4
parent9e05516e12b2d480ae1ac3e5484af00513087263 (diff)
downloadnotification-15790afec1c924540e7c3ec613c5b3d2adcbed46.tar.gz
notification-15790afec1c924540e7c3ec613c5b3d2adcbed46.tar.bz2
notification-15790afec1c924540e7c3ec613c5b3d2adcbed46.zip
Fix memory leak
Change-Id: I9cd3053c71053b2d7ad5a1ec638e1edd1c345a2e Signed-off-by: Changgyu Choi <changyu.choi@samsung.com>
-rw-r--r--notification/src/notification_ipc.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/notification/src/notification_ipc.c b/notification/src/notification_ipc.c
index a4c79a4..2c2a5cf 100644
--- a/notification/src/notification_ipc.c
+++ b/notification/src/notification_ipc.c
@@ -481,6 +481,7 @@ static void _delete_multiple_notify(GVariant *parameters)
buf = (int *)malloc(sizeof(int) * num);
if (buf == NULL) {
ERR("Failed to alloc");
+ g_variant_iter_free(iter);
return;
}
@@ -523,6 +524,7 @@ static void _delete_by_display_applist_notify(GVariant *parameters)
buf = (int *)malloc(sizeof(int) * num);
if (buf == NULL) {
ERR("Failed to alloc");
+ g_variant_iter_free(iter);
return;
}